Respondent determined a $2,257 deficiency in petitioners' 1977 federal income tax.

The issue for decision is whether any part of a $15,000 amount which petitioner Joseph Edward Custis received from the Air Force on completion of his military service is excludable from income under section 104(a)(4).1
